The 2nd trend on our list of top cloud trends is the accelerated adoption and use of hybrid and multi-cloud modals. A hybrid cloud environment is one in which an organization chooses to divide its information in between a public cloud and a private cloud or on-prem data center.

A multi-cloud environment is another computing set-up in which business spread their infrastructure throughout 2 or more cloud environments. This technique yields numerous benefits, such as increased flexibility, access to specific functions of various cloud environments, and no fear of supplier lock-in. Companies are currently buying hybrid and multi-cloud architectures to support their functions, guarantee higher client satisfaction, and lower advancement costs.
